Background
The single-blade capping machine is suitable for sealing 2 ml-25 ml antibiotic tube bottles and molded bottles, and can automatically finish the processes of bottle sorting, bottle feeding, capping, bottle discharging and the like.
The capping machine is widely applied to the fields of pharmacy, food, scientific education and the like, disposable products such as medicines, health care and the like are basically packaged in bottles, the capping machine is required to be used for capping in order to ensure the quality of the products in the bottles, but the existing capping machine has the defects of insecure rolled opening, poor sealing property and high breakage rate.

The working principle is as follows: when the machine is started, a bottle arranging mechanism and an oscillator are firstly started, after bottles and aluminum caps are fully distributed on a bottle feeding track and an aluminum cap track, the main machine is started to enable the whole machine to operate, moving parts are carefully observed during operation, normal production can be carried out without abnormal shaking and noise, the bottle arranging mechanism conveys scattered bottles to a shifting wheel and then enters a rotary table so as to carry out capping and capping, the cap arranging mechanism adopts an electromagnetic oscillation type cap arranging mechanism, the vibration of an oscillator hopper is caused by the vibration of an electromagnet in the oscillator hopper, the scattered aluminum caps in the hopper are orderly arranged so as to enter a guide rail to carry out capping, a small belt wheel 18, a large belt wheel 19, a gear A20, a gear B21, a central shaft 22, a gear C23, a gear D24, a cam 25 and a lower rotary table 26 are jointly rotated by installing a three-phase asynchronous motor 17, eight bottle holder bases 29 and bottle holder bases 27 are respectively distributed on the upper rotary table 30 and the lower rotary table 26, the bottle is rotated and moved up and down along the fixed cam 25 on the bottle supporting seat 27 around the rolling cutter 10, so as to achieve the purpose of capping, thereby driving the bottle to cap around the rolling cutter 10, greatly improving the working efficiency, the capping adopts a rolling type planetary mechanism, the difference of the appearance size of the bottle can be automatically regulated, the position of a rolled opening needs to be regulated due to the bottle height and other reasons when capping, the up-and-down regulation direction of the rolling cutter 10 is determined when capping is regulated, then the locking nut 9 or the rolling head regulating nut 16 is respectively loosened to regulate the rolling cutter to a proper position, then the rolling head regulating nut 16 or the locking nut 9 is fastened and the screw 11 is rotated, so that the pulling plate 12 drives the rolling cutter 10 to move back and forth, namely the magnitude of the rolling force can be completed, thereby reducing the breakage rate of the bottle and improving the qualification rate of capping, the bottle discharging is that the sealed bottle is sent into a bottle discharging track through a shifting wheel and then is directly taken into a bottle discharging disc, thereby transporting the finished product out of the machine.
